Description: |
Photographically illustrated book, entitled Photographs Executed Expressly for the Crystal Palace Art-Union (Sydenham, London: Crystal Palace Co., 1859), containing nine photographs (albumen print) by Philip H. (Philip Henry) Delamotte (British, 1821-1889). |
